Understanding BMC Mold Tools

BMC stands for Bulk Molding Compound. This material is known for its excellent durability and resistance to heat. When it comes to tools, the BMC mold tool in China is becoming a standard for various industries, including automotive and electronics. This tool allows manufacturers to produce reliable parts with precision.

Traditional Designs: Tried and True

Traditional BMC mold tools have served the industry well. These tools have a simple construction, allowing for easier manufacturing processes. They often involve standard molds with less intricate designs. The advantages of traditional designs include lower production costs and shorter lead times.

However, these benefits come with limitations. Traditional methods do not always allow for high complexity in part designs. As industries evolve, the need for more sophisticated solutions increases. This is where innovation steps in, enhancing the capabilities of BMC mold tools.

Innovative Designs: The Future of Mold Making

Innovative designs in the BMC mold tool in China are paving the way for more efficient manufacturing. Advanced technologies, such as computer-aided design (CAD) and simulation software, have transformed mold making. Precise modeling allows engineers to create intricate mold shapes that were previously unimaginable.

These innovative designs also employ advanced materials and techniques. For example, hybrid molds that combine different materials offer unique benefits. They allow for the production of lightweight yet sturdy parts. This flexibility makes it easier to meet specific industry requirements.
